While mold remediation after the fact is a job for a skilled professional, household mold prevention is largely up to you. Stopping mold growth before it happens is the preferred scenario and by far the most cost-efficient option. Dormant mold spores are everywhere, but they remain inert unless certain cons exist. Effective mold prevention means intervening to eliminate those conditions before active growth occurs. Here are 8 things you can do yourself.
DIY Mold Prevention Tips
- Be consistent " Avoid acute temperature swings in the home. Keep temperatures close to 78 degrees year-round.
- Reduce humidity " Once indoor humidity reaches 60 percent, dormant mold spores can become active. Consider installing a whole-house dehumidifier to remove excess moisture and prevent mold growth, as well as make the house more comfortable.
- Eliminate wet spots " Fix ongoing moisture sources like dripping plumbing pipes, a leaky roof and refrigerator or freezer drip pans that are always wet.
- Have the A/C checked " If indoor humidity is chronically on the high side, your air conditioner may be malfunctioning. An HVAC contractor can check parameters such as airflow and refrigerant level to ensure proper dehumidifying performance.
- Dry the crawl space " Ground moisture seeping up through a dirt crawl space infiltrates water vapor into the home. Cover the crawl space floor with a plastic vapor barrier.
- Seal ductwork " Leaky supply ducts depressurize the house, sucking outdoor humidity into indoor wall voids and other areas where moisture will trigger mold growth.
- Monitor conditions " A thermometer isn't enough. Install an indoor humidity monitor to let you know if conditions become favorable for mold growth.
